SPANISH SPICED ALMONDS



Spanish Spiced Almonds image

Creamy, sweet marcona almonds are toasted and tossed in a flavorful paprika-spiked spice blend in this recipe for Spanish spiced almonds.

Provided by Just a Little Bit of Bacon

Categories     Appetizer

Time 5m

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 cup marcona almonds
2 tsp extra virgin olive oil
3/4 tsp smoked paprika
1 pinch coriander
1 pinch cayenne, (more if needed)
1/2 tsp kosher salt

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400F.
  • Spread out the almonds on a baking sheet. Bake for 5-6 min, or until golden brown.
  • In a medium bowl, mix together the olive oil, paprika, coriander, cayenne, and salt. Toss the almonds with the spice blend. Taste to see if they need more cayenne. Add another pinch if necessary. Serve.

THYME-ROASTED MARCONA ALMONDS



Thyme-Roasted Marcona Almonds image

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     appetizer

Time 20m

Yield 6 to 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 pound roasted, salted Marcona almonds
2 teaspoons good olive oil
2 tablespoons minced fresh thyme leaves
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1 teaspoon fleur de sel

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ees.
  • Place the almonds, olive oil, thyme, and kosher salt on a sheet pan and toss them together. Roast the almonds for 10 to 15 minutes, turning them every 5 minutes with a metal spatula, until they're lightly browned. Watch them carefully; they go from under baked to burnt very quickly. Sprinkle with the fleur de sel, toss, and set aside to cool. Serve warm or at room temperature.

CUMIN-AND-PAPRIKA-SPICED MARCONA ALMONDS



Cumin-and-Paprika-Spiced Marcona Almonds image

Almonds were brought to Spain by the Moors, and they've featured in Andalusian cuisine ever since. Typically they are used as a thickener for sauces and, most famously, as the base of ajo blanco. Whole Marcona almonds are roasted with sweet or hot smoked paprika-I prefer to use sweet paprika, introduce a little heat via cayenne, and round it out with cumin and salt. In the event of a crippling Marcona almond shortage, regular blanched almonds will do the trick.

Provided by Talia Baiocchi

Yield Makes 3 cups

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 egg white
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
1 teaspoon plus 1/8 teaspoon cumin, for dusting
1 teaspoon plus 1/8 teaspoon sweet or smoked Spanish paprika, for dusting
1/4 teaspoon cayenne
3 cups blanched Marcona almonds

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350°F.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• In a bowl, whisk together the egg white, salt, 1 teaspoon of cumin, 1 teaspoon of paprika, and the cayenne. Add the almonds and toss to coat.
  • Spread the almonds out evenly on the prepared baking sheet and roast until golden brown, 20 to 25 minutes, shaking the pan halfway through. Transfer to a plate to cool for about 30 minutes.
  • In a small bowl, combine the remaining 1/8 teaspoon of cumin and the remaining 1/8 teaspoon of paprika. Sprinkle this mixture over the cooled nuts. Store in a sealed container for up to 2 weeks.

ROMESCO SAUCE WITH MARCONA ALMONDS



Romesco Sauce With Marcona Almonds image

Provided by Florence Fabricant

Categories     condiments, sauces and gravies

Time 40m

Yield 1 1/2 cups

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 dried ñora chiles available in Spanish markets and online, or 1 ancho chile
4 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
25 marcona almonds
15 skinned hazelnuts or additional almonds
1 cup small cubes of stale sourdough bread
4 cloves garlic, peeled and sliced
2 jarred piquillo peppers, drained and chopped
1 medium ripe tomato, peeled, seeded and chopped about 2/3 cup
2/3 cup dry white wine
1 tablespoon sherry vinegar
1/2 teaspoon smoked Spanish paprika, sweet or hot, or to taste
Salt

Steps:

  • Cut the chiles in half, place in a bowl and cover with boiling water, weighing them down with a plate to keep them submerged. Set aside for 30 minutes.
  • Heat oil in a small skillet over medium heat. Add the almonds, hazelnuts and bread cubes and stir until they start to brown, 6 to 8 minutes. Add the garlic, and stir until lightly browned. Add the piquillo peppers. Remove from heat.
  • Drain the chiles, and remove stems and seeds. Chop the chiles, add them to the pan, heat and stir briefly. Add the tomato, stir and cook a minute or so until softened. Remove from heat.
  • Transfer to a food processor or a blender and pulse until a rough paste is formed. With the machine running, slowly pour in the wine. Turn off the machine, add vinegar, paprika and salt, to taste, then pulse briefly to blend. The sauce will have a slightly nubbly texture.

SPICED SPANISH ALMONDS



Spiced Spanish Almonds image

Salty, sweet and laced with smoke -- the perfect kind of almond for a party. If any remain the next day, savor them over a salad topped with sliced ripe pears and shaved Manchego cheese. From 'EatingWell.com' and posted for ZWT5. NOTE: Cooling time included in PREP time.

Number Of Ingredients 10

1/4 cup light brown sugar
2 teaspoons ground cumin
1 teaspoon hot paprika or 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
1 teaspoon dried thyme
1 teaspoon kosher sea salt
1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1 large egg white
1 tablespoon water
1 lb marcona almonds (about 3 cups) or 1 lb raw whole almond (about 3 cups)
cooking spray

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 275°F Coat a large rimmed baking sheet with cooking spray.
  • Whisk brown sugar, cumin, paprika, thyme, salt and cayenne in a large bowl.
  • Whisk egg white and water in a medium bowl until foamy.
  • Add almonds to egg mixture and stir to coat; pour through a sieve to drain off excess egg white.
  • Transfer the almonds to the bowl of spices; stir well to coat.
  • Spread evenly on the prepared baking sheet.
  • Bake the almonds for 30 minutes.
  • Stir, reduce the oven temperature to 200F and bake until almonds are dry and golden, about 30 minutes more.
  • Let cool before serving, 15 to 20 minutes.
  • Store in an airtight container for up to 1 week.
  • NOTE: Spanish Marcona almonds have recently become more popular and more available. They're a little flatter than ordinary almonds, with a richer flavor. Always skinned, most Marcona almonds have already been sauteed in oil and lightly salted when you get them. For this recipe, select unsalted and oil-free nuts if you can, though either will work well. You can find them in specialty stores.

CITRUS & SPICE MARCONA ALMONDS



Citrus & Spice Marcona Almonds image

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 large egg white
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on ground cumin
1 orange, juiced and zested
1/4 teaspoon paprika (choose a flavorful Spanish smoked hot or sweet)
2 cups blanched almonds (brown skins removed)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F
  • Line a large baking sheet with parchment.
  • Whisk together egg white, orange juice, zest, salt, cumin, and paprika in a bowl, then add almonds and toss to coat.
  • Spread almonds evenly on baking sheet for 10 minutes. Remove from oven and mix the nuts around, return to oven for another 10 minutes or until golden.
  • Transfer nuts on parchment to a rack and cool completely (almonds will crisp as they cool).
  • Loosen nuts from parchment with a spatula and transfer to a bowl.
  • Note: These almonds can be made several days in advance and kept in an airtight container at room temperature.
